Book excerpt: Excerpt from Iran, Agricultural Production and Trade As this report goes to press, a number of changes taking place in Iran will significantly alter the future of the country. As the leading exporter of crude oil in the world, Iran is benefiting greatly from the increased prices. Its earnings from oil exports in calendar year 1974 are likely to total around billion, compared with billion in calendar 1972. The tremendous increases in oil revenue will most certainly affect a further reconsideration of the Third 5-year Development Plan, which began in March 1973. AI ready at that time, the Plan was under revision due to the revaluation upward of the Iranian rial. Now further extensive revisions are being forma lated for utilizing the dramatic increases in foreign exchange earnings.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Foreign Agriculture, Vol. 9: A Review of Foreign Farm Policy, Production, and Trade; March 1945 Whenever a global conflict takes place, inevitably the Middle East plays a strategic role, largely because of its unique geographical position, bringing into physical contact the three Continents of Asia, Africa, and Europe. Here the East and West have met, and decisive world battles have been fought. During this war, at El 'alamein in Egypt, at Stalingrad, and in the Caucasus, near the northern borders of Turkey and Iran, the tide of battle was finally turned against the Axis. Perhaps more important than its strategic military position is the role played by the Middle East within the orbit of world economic relations. There are in Iran, Iraq, and Arabia huge reservoirs of oil, only a few of which have been tapped. The region has been developing into an increasingly important market for industrial products of various sorts and, on the other hand, has been able to export substantial quantities of agricultural commodities.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Cotton in Iran Iran's cotton exports, its second largest foreign exchange earner, are expected to continue competing with us. Cotton during the next few years. No intensification of rivalry is foreseen, however, because rising domestic consumption should utilize most of the expected increase in production. Iranian cotton, which competes with us. Medium and longer staple upland fibers, is highly regarded both in world markets and by the country's domestic textile mills but practically all the higher quality cotton is exported. In recent years, about three-fourths of Iran's exports have been shipped under trade agreements to Communist countries, mainly the Czechoslovakia, Hungary, Romania, Yugoslavia, and Poland. The rest has gone mostly to Japan and the United Kingdom - major us. Markets. Iran's foreign earnings from cotton exports are exceeded only by those from petroleum and petroleum products. Cotton exports in 1970-71 (august-july crop year) are estimated at a record of bales (480 lb. Net), ranking seventh in world cotton exports. The 1970-71 level compares with bales a year earlier and the previous record of bales in 1965-66. Shipments should range around to bales a year, as cotton production is expected to increase during the next few years.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Agricultural Trade Highlights: April 1993 Exports of wheat and wheat flour in February rose 9 percent to $455 million on a 4 percent gain in volume. Most of the increase occurred in ship ments to Morocco, India, China, and Nigeria, which were up $31 million, $22 million, $21 million and $11 mil lion, respectively. Decreased sales were largely limited to the former So viet Union and Pakistan, down $80 million and $44 million, respectively. Excluding sales to the former Soviet Union and Pakistan, sales were up strongly. February shipments of coarse grains fell 12 percent to $457 million. This decline was due entirely to lower prices as volume rose by 1 percent. Losses were heaviest to the former So viet Union, Japan, and Mexico which were down $93 million, $64 million, and $20 million, respectively. Gains were more modest, but widespread, led by South Africa and Egypt, which were $38 million and $16 million higher, respectively. Exports of oilseeds and products rose 11 percent in February to $912 mil lion, on an equivalent gain in volume. Most of this gain came in soybean sales to the ec, Indonesia, and Malay sia which were up $112 million, $14 million and $12 million, respectively. U.s. Sales to the EC were unusually high due to lower than usual South American supplies at this time of year. Losses were most pronounced to Korea, Taiwan, and the former Soviet Union, down $27 million, $20 million and $18 million respectively. In addi tion, the former Soviet Union showed a $30 million decline in soybean meal sales and $16 million lower soybean oil purchases. Rice exports for February jumped 61 percent over year ago levels, to $77 million, on an 82 percent gain in vol ume. Modest sales gains were wide spread, led by Turkey and Iran, which were up $12 million, each, followed by South Africa up $7 million), and Saudi Arabia (up $5 million).
